Eggshell Rock Blaze vs Indian Hare
Phlyctis petraea compared with Lepus nigricollis
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Eggshell Rock Blaze | Indian Hare |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Fungi (Fungi)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Lecanoromycetes (Lecanoromycetes)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Ostropales (Ostropales) |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) |
| Family | Phlyctidaceae |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) |
| Genus | Phlyctis | Lepus |
| Species | Phlyctis petraea | Lepus nigricollis |
